In a recent report, rebel militants from Ethiopia’s Tigray area are accused of committing major violations of humanitarian law.
According to an Amnesty International report, Tigrayan rebels engaged in gang rape and deliberately killed civilians in the nearby Amhara region, where they had control for a time before being forced out by government forces two months ago.
According to Amnesty International, in the town of Kobo, rebel soldiers slaughtered unarmed civilians and sexually abused at least 30 women and girls in Chena hamlet.
The Tigray People’s Liberation Front has not replied to the current allegations, but has previously refuted similar accusations. Summary executions and rape have also been accused of Ethiopian government troops.
